Frequently Asked Questions

What is the first critical step I should take after discovering water damage?

Immediately locate and shut off the main water valve. This is the single most effective action to stop the 'loss of use' clock and mitigate damage. For residents near Tropical Park, know your valve's location beforehand. Then, contact your utility provider to secure the service. Rapid source cessation is the cornerstone of all effective mitigation and is the first item documented in our emergency response log.

How soon must water mitigation begin to prevent mold in my Westwood Lakes home?

The microbial growth window is 48-72 hours post-intrusion. By 2026, insurance carriers and liability standards consider mitigation initiated after this window as a failure in the Standard of Care. Delayed action shifts liability for resultant mold remediation to the property owner. Immediate extraction and controlled drying are required to arrest spore amplification within this critical timeframe.

Why is a Westwood Lakes area that feels 'dry to the touch' still dangerously wet?

Per the IICRC S500 standard for Miami-Dade humidity, 'dry' is defined by psychrometrics, not touch. Ambient air in Westwood Lakes holds significant moisture, measured in Grains Per Pound (GPP). A surface can feel dry while vapor pressure drives moisture into porous building materials. Our target is to achieve a stable 40 GPP @ 70°F environment within the structure, which requires industrial dehumidification to prevent secondary damage.
